Treatment The goal of treatment is to minimize pain, gradual the progression of harm, and preserve or establish muscle mass. Treatment is obtained with a combination of therapies, which may include any of the next: Way of living alterations: Weight control Lower-effects routines, for instance leash walks or swimming Usage of non-slip rugs and ramps to obtain on beds, couches or automobiles Bodily rehabilitation: Underwater treadmill Choice of movement exercises or other therapeutic modalities — which includes acupuncture, LASER therapy plus more Pain management: NSAIDs (n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s) are commonly prescribed drugs to handle OA pain and inflammation. Your Doggy will require program checking with blood function whenever they involve lengthy-expression NSAIDs. Supplemental medications, for example gabapentin and amantadine, may very well be presented together with NSAIDs. Librela (bedinvetmab) is actually a style of injectable medication referred to as a monoclonal antibody that could be given when every month to provide for a longer time-expression Charge of OA pain. It targets a selected driver of OA pain named nerve development element (NGF). Joint support: Supplements, for example glucosamine and chondroitin sulfate, and omega-3 fatty acids Joint injections, like platelet-wealthy plasma, stem mobile therapy or RSO (radiosynoviorthesis or model title Synovetin OA) Operation: Can be encouraged for some instances which have underlying causes of OA, which include hip dysplasia, cranial cruciate ligament rupture and elbow dysplasia, between Many others Final result OA causes progressive harm to useful link afflicted joints, try this site as well as the prognosis may differ with regards to the fundamental result in and severity. When there isn't any get rid of for OA, there are several techniques to control pain and hold off its development, allowing numerous dogs to Dwell comfortably using a multimodal method of treatment. The sooner OA is diagnosed and managed prior to the serious development of OA, the higher the extended-time period result. Photograph provided.
